Body Positivity

Embracing Every Body

We live in a society where having the

ideal body is necessary to succeed.

Nevertheless, what if we could develop love?

Our bodies, just how they are now?

We are constantly exposed to beautiful

photographs and told that we

are too big or not enough.

The ultimate goal is to learn to love yourself,

but the truth is that beauty comes

in various forms and sizes.

We should treat our bodies with respect and love

because they carry us through life and

because we are stronger, smarter, and

more creative than merely how we look.

Let's concentrate on what we can do

rather than what we cannot achieve.

Let's honor our bodies for whatever they are.

Moreover, practice loving your body and soul.

GIVE YOURSELF A BIG HUG!

This poem emphasizes the value of self-love and body acceptance as well as the pressure society places on people to adhere to a particular body type. It inspires us to accept our bodies, regardless of their size or shape, and to put more emphasis on our abilities and strengths than on our perceived shortcomings. It encourages us to treat our bodies with respect and love by serving as a reminder that they are our vehicles for experiencing life. In the end, the poem advises us to have a positive relationship with our own bodies while also recognizing the beauty and uniqueness of all bodies.
